Google and On2, today, jointly made the announcement of Google acquiring On2. On2′s product portfolio includes Advanced Video Compression, Video Encoding & Publishing and Embedded solutions for Chips and Devices. Please click here to view On2′s complete Product Portfolio.

Oracle 11g Certification coming soon
Good news for all the Oracle 11g Database Administrator Certification aspirants. Paul has just confirmed that Oracle is soon to launch the OCP (Oracle Certified Professional) Certification for its latest 11g Database Administration.
The beta period for the Certification, “1Z1-053 – Oracle Database 11g: Administration II” closed recently. This is a single exam requirement for ones holding the Oracle DB 11g Administrator Certified Associate (OCA), and gives them the opportunity to upgrade to the coveted OCP.
ORACLE announces new release of Coherence
Now, this is going to come as good news to all the Application Grid Professionals.
Oracle Coherence is an in-memory data grid solution from the Oracle stable. It allows organizations to scale mission critical applications by providing fast and reliable access to frequently used data. It enables real time data analysis, in memory grid computations, parallel transaction and event processing, and Application Grid Computing.

Oracle buys IP Assets of Conformia
Oracle recently announced that it has acquired the Intellectual Property Assets of Conformia. Looks like Oracle is at it again.
Conformia is one of the world’s leading Enterprise Software provider for Process / Product Lifecycle Management (PPLM). Their software is popular in regulated Process Manufacturing Industries like Life Sciences (to manage drug design, development of products across bio, Pharmaceutical and Chemical Drug Components, etc.) and Beverage Alcohol.
